Report Reveals Poor Conditions at Perth Sheriff Court Custody
4/2/2026
1 of 1
Story summary
- A report found poor conditions at the Perth Sheriff Court custody unit in Scotland: cold cells and inadequate heating.
- Graffiti and structural damage were noted, with staff providing warm clothing to detainees.
- Many issues persisted since a 2020 inspection, requiring refurbishment.
- HM Chief Inspector Sara Snell urged urgent investment to meet standards.
- The Scottish Courts and Tribunal Service acknowledged the report and will collaborate with agencies to improve detainee conditions.
